首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用从其中一列引用的值来转置和添加新列

在云计算领域中,使用从其中一列引用的值来转置和添加新列可以通过以下步骤实现:

  1. 首先,需要使用适当的编程语言和技术来处理数据。常见的编程语言包括Python、Java、C++等,可以根据具体需求选择合适的语言。
  2. 读取数据:使用适当的库或工具,如Pandas、NumPy等,读取包含所需数据的文件。这可以是CSV、Excel、JSON等格式的文件。
  3. 转置数据:使用相应的函数或方法,将数据进行转置。例如,在Python中,可以使用Pandas库的transpose()函数来实现。
  4. 引用值并添加新列:根据需要,使用适当的方法从转置后的数据中引用特定列的值,并将其添加为新列。这可以通过遍历数据、使用索引或条件语句等方式实现。
  5. 存储数据:将转置后的数据保存到适当的文件或数据库中,以便后续使用或分析。

这种转置和添加新列的操作在数据处理和分析中非常常见,特别适用于需要对数据进行重组和重新组织的情况。例如,可以将某一列的值作为新列的标识符或属性,并将其与其他相关数据进行关联或比较。

腾讯云提供了一系列与数据处理和分析相关的产品和服务,例如云数据库 TencentDB、云数据仓库 Tencent Data Warehouse、云原生数据库 TDSQL、云数据迁移服务 DTS 等。这些产品可以帮助用户在云环境中高效地处理和分析数据,提供稳定可靠的数据存储和计算能力。

更多关于腾讯云数据产品的详细介绍和使用指南,可以参考腾讯云官方文档:腾讯云数据产品

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何用Tableau获取数据?

如何 Excel 获取数据? 如何数据库获取数据? 如何编辑数据? 如何添加更多数据源? 如何行列? 1.连接到数据源 下面的案例Excel表里记录了咖啡销售数据。...: 数据源中选择箭头所指放歌红框内图标,可以修改数据类型: 作表中,选择相应字段还可以进行重命名 复制或隐藏等: 数据源中,选择倒三角或列名,也可以进行重命名 复制或隐藏等...,在里面输入新字段名/列名计算公式,则可新增字段/: 5.如何添加更多数据源?...Tableau可视化效果建模工具最适用于列式数据,也就是我们通常看到Excel按每一列名排列数据。但是,有时候给到你是按行排列如何实现行列呢?...如图所示,在工作表中直接点击功能栏中交换行即可: 在数据源中,也有功能,不过数据源里时多个字段: 需要选择多个字段进行: 点击数据选项”后,可以将多个字段

5.1K20

pandas

1961/1/8 0:00:00 4.pandas中series与DataFrame区别 Series是带索引一维数组 Series对象两个重要属性是:index(索引)value(数据)...DataFrame任意一行或者一列就是一个Series对象 创建Series对象:pd.Series(data,index=index)   其中data可以是很多类型: 一个列表----------...df.to_excel("dates.xlsx") 向pandas中插入数据 如果想忽略行索引插入,又不想缺失数据与添加NaN,建议使用 df['column_name'].values得出是..._append(temp, ignore_index=True) pandas数据 与矩阵相同,在 Pandas 中,我们可以使用 .transpose() 方法或 .T 属性 我们DataFrame...通常情况下, 因为.T简便性, 更常使用.T属性进行 注意 不会影响原来数据,所以如果想保存数据,请将赋给一个变量再保存。

12310
  • C++ 特殊矩阵压缩算法

    矩阵内置操作有很多,本文选择矩阵操作对比压缩前压缩后算法差异性。 什么是矩阵? 如有 m行nA 矩阵,所谓,指把A变成 n行m B矩阵。...存储角度而言,aArray矩阵bArray矩阵都是稀疏矩阵,使用二维数组存储会浪费大量空间。有必要对其以三元组表形式进行压缩存储。...三元组表是一个一维数组,因其中每一个存储位置需要存储原稀疏矩阵中非零数据3 个信息(行,)。三元组表名由此而来,也就是说数组中存储是对象。...或者说 ,矩阵还是使用三元组表方式描述。 先从直观上了解一下,B矩稀疏阵三元组表结构应该是什么样子。 是否可以通过直接交换A三元组表中行列位置中?...至于可不可以,可以先用演示图推演一下: 图示可知,如果仅是交换A三元组表列位置后得到三元组表并不和前面所推演出现B三元组表一致。

    2K30

    怎么将多行多数据变成一列?4个解法。

    - 问题 - 怎么将这个多行多数据 变成一列?...- 1 - 不需保持原排序 选中所有 逆透视,一步搞定 - 2 - 保持原排序:操作法一 思路直接,为保排序,操作麻烦 2.1 添加索引 2.2 替换null,避免逆透视时行丢失,后续无法排序...2.3 逆透视其他 2.4 再添加索引 2.5 对索引取模(取模时输入参数为源表数,如3) 2.6 修改公式中取模参数,使能适应增加动态变化 2.7 再排序并删 2.8...筛选掉原替换null行 - 3 - 保持排序:操作法二 先,行标丢失,列名可排序 有时候,换个思路,问题简单很多 3.1 3.2 添加索引 3.3 逆透视 3.4 删 -...4 - 公式一步法 用Table.ToColumns把表分成 用List.Combine将多追加成一列 用List.Select去除其中null

    3.3K20

    常见复制粘贴,VBA是怎么做

    此表显示了100名不同销售经理按单位数总美元价值对特定项目(A、B、C、DE)销售额。第一行(主表上方)显示每个项目的单价,最后一列显示每位经理销售总值。...上述示例1示例2中都是这种情况,其中,尽管工作表发生了更改,目标仍然是单元格B5到M107。这保证了混合引用继续指向正确单元格。...相反,它使用单元格F5作为源工作表复制混合引用结果。这将导致(i)错误结果(ii)循环引用。...Transpose参数允许指定粘贴时是否复制区域(交换位置),可以设置为True或Flase。...如果Transpose设置为True,粘贴时行列;如果设置为False,Excel不会任何内容。该参数默认为False。如果忽略该参数,Excel不会复制区域

    11.8K20

    如何把多维数据转换成一维数据?

    项目时间在行列顺序是互换,这个肯定会涉及到功能。 我们看2种解法: (一) 通过函数分割后转合并。 我们看一个函数Table.Partition。...对每一个表用表格里一列第一个作为表说明。...Table.AddColumn(删除其他, "自定义.1", each [自定义][Column1]{0}) 添加并取自定义表Column1第1行作为表说明。 ? 5....(二) 使用自定义函数 之前我们有做过一个关于多数据组合自定义函数。 Power Query中如何把多数据合并? Power Query中如何把多数据合并?升级篇 ? 1....使用自定义函数进行多合并 批量多合并(表,Table.ColumnCount(表)/7,7,0) 解释: 第1参数代表需要处理表,表代表上个过程表 第2参数代表是循环次数,这里实际转换是

    2.7K10

    Matlab系列之矩阵秀

    ~ 1、 是个很好理解东西,就是相当于将原本行列转了一下,行列之间关系做了对调,还没懂?...先是直接产生一个3行2矩阵A,然后使用冒号功能,直接变成了只有一列矩阵B,最后使用reshape函数将矩阵A变成了2行3矩阵C,且从中都可以看到,他们都是按顺序进行重新排列,第一列排完了才接着下一列数据...序号下标的对应关系也已经说过,以一个m x n 矩阵A为例,A(i,j)表示第i行j元素,其序号就是:(j-1)*m+i,当然你也可以直接一列一列数 ? ? ? ? ?...除了以上几种使用具体维数,获得子矩阵方法外,还可以end运算符结合起来获取子矩阵,end在以前篇章中也有过介绍,就是代表所在维最后一行或者最后一列,继续用这个A矩阵简单看下使用结果:...此外还要一些函数也可以实现拼接功能,如cat,调用格式:C=cat(dim,A,B) 其中dim就是拼接方向,AB就是待拼接矩阵,C就是拼接后矩阵,当然也可以使用多个矩阵进行,比如C=cat(dim

    1.3K30

    你绝对不知道Excel选择性粘贴技巧

    可以说,选择性粘贴具有非凡魔性,对复制数据进行各种各样改造,我归纳了12大功能,最后一个你绝对不会。...操作方法:选择表格区域并复制,在另一区域点击右键→粘贴选项→ 保留源宽 不管区域宽是多少,也无论粘贴数据有多少列,粘贴之后数据区域原始区域保持一样宽。...Top 7:超级行列 应用场景:在做表格转化时经常使用,可以将一行转化为一列一列转化为一行。...操作方法:选取并复制表格,选取要粘贴单元格,右键→ 选择性粘贴 → Top 6:粘贴为带链接图片 应用场景:这是粘贴图片升级版,不仅具备粘贴图片所有好处,而且当源表修改后,带链接图片上数据也会同步发生变化...Top2:在图表中添加系列 应用场景:比如,我们已经根据以下数据做好了山东广东销售数据图表,现在我们需要添加另外一个省份数据到图表中。

    71120

    手把手教你学numpy——、reshape与where

    我们可以看到置之后矩阵一列其实是原矩阵第一行,第一行是原矩阵一列。可以看成是原矩阵按照左上角到右下角一条无形线翻转之后结果。 理解了置之后,我们再来看reshape操作。...本质上来说reshape操作其实就是按照顺序矩阵当中获取元素,然后按照我们制定shape填充出一个矩阵操作。...这个应该不难理解, 它也是非常常用重塑操作,通过reshape,我们可以很方便地操作矩阵大小,根据我们需要作出改变。...在这个例子当中,c数组中10分别表示TrueFalse。当我们调用np.where时候,numpy会自动根据c数组当中去选择a数组还是b数组当中获取数据。...这一点光看书或者是资料是很难穷尽,所以如果你已经学会了这些api基本使用,接下来最应该做是去读一些大牛源码,看看大牛们是如何运用这些工具,相信一定还会有收货。

    1.3K10

    LogisticRegression(逻辑回归)

    在文章中主要写了其推导过程以及部分代码实现 # 构造函数h(x) 其中sigmoid函数形式为: 对应函数图像是一个取值在01之间曲线: 因为: 由上两式联立可得: # 使用极大似然估计法...更新过程可以转化为: 综合起来就是: 综上所述,vectorization后θ更新步骤如下 : 求A=x*θ 求E=g(A)-y 求θ:=θ-α.x'.E,x'表示矩阵x 最后,向量化参数更新公式为...:return: """ data = np.loadtxt('testSet.txt') # 取数据集一列到最后一列一列 dataMat = data...[:, 0:-1] # 取数据集最后一列 lableMat = data[:, -1] # 为dataMat添加一列1,代表所有theta0参数,其中0代表第1,1代表需要插入数值...""" # 将特征数组转化为矩阵形式 dataMatrix = np.mat(dataMat) # 将标签数据转化为矩阵并取矩阵 labelMatrix

    32510

    基于Excel2013PowerQuery入门

    提取2.png 选定产生一列转换数据类型为整数 ? 转化1.png ? 转化2.png ? 转化3.png ? 转换4.png ? 转换5.png ? 转换6.png ?...成功删除错误行.png 7.反转 打开下载文件中07-反转.xlsx,如下图所示。 ? 打开文件图示.png ? 加载数据到PowerQuery中.png ?...按钮位置.png ? 后结果.png ? 将第一行作为标题.png ? 取消自动更改类型.png ? 关闭并上载至原有表格.png ? 上载设置.png ?...结果.png 如果上载位置有偏差,自己可以移动表格位置调整至上图所示效果 8.透视逆透视 打开下载文件中08-透视逆透视.xlsx,如下图所示 ?...打开文件图示.png 不要选中第一列,选中后面的,然后点击下图所示逆透视。 ? 逆透视1.png ? 成功逆透视结果.png 选择关闭并上载至,在窗口中设置如下图所示。

    10K50

    数据结构——全篇1.1万字保姆级吃透串与数组(超详细)

    如果索引号不是0开始,需要先将索引号归零,再使用公式。                 5.3.2序:使用内存中一维空间(一片连续存储空间),以方式存放二维数组。...特点:矩阵N[m×n] 通过 矩阵M[n×m] 原则:前从左往右查看每一列数据,后就是一行一行数据。                ...快速算法:求出N一列第一个非零元素在TM中行号,然后扫描TN,把该列上元素依次存放于TM相应位置上。...基本思想:分析原稀疏矩阵数据,得到与后数据关系 每一列第一个元素位置:上一列第一个元素位置 + 上一列非零元素个数 当前列,原第一个位置如果已经处理,第二个将更新成第一个位置。....column; num[j]++; } // 5 后每一列第一个元素位置数组 int cpot = new int[cols]; // 5.1

    1.8K60

    Apache Hudi数据跳过技术加速查询高达50倍

    但是如果有一个排序一个范围......还有最小最大!现在意味着每个 Parquet 文件一列都有明确定义最小最大(也可以为 null)。...为方便起见我们对上表进行,使每一行对应一个文件,而每个统计列将分叉为每个数据自己副本: 这种表示为数据跳过提供了一个非常明确案例:对于由统计索引索引 C1、C2、......这种方法正是 Spark/Hive 其他引擎所做,例如,当他们 Parquet 文件中读取数据时——每个单独 Parquet 文件都存储自己统计信息(对于每一列),并且谓词过滤器被推送到 Parquet...实际上意味着对于具有大量大型表,我们不需要读取整个统计索引,并且可以通过查找查询中引用简单地投影其部分。 设计 在这里,我们将介绍统计索引设计一些关键方面。...基准测试 为了全面演示统计索引和数据跳过功能,我们将使用众所周知 Amazon 评论数据集(仅占用 50Gb 存储空间),以便任何人都可以轻松复制我们结果,但是使用稍微不常见摄取配置展示统计索引和数据跳过带来效率如何随着数据集中文件数量而变化

    1.8K50

    如何用Power BI获取数据?

    image.png (3)内容页面:显示当前表格内容。 (4)查询设置:列出查询属性已应用步骤。 选中要编辑列名,鼠标右键,可以出现:表中删除、以新名称复制或替换。...image.png 每个步骤都会显示在“查询设置”窗格上“已应用步骤”列表中。你可以使用此列表撤消或查看特定更改,点击X即可。还可以更改步骤名称。...选择“关闭并应用”后,Power Query编辑器将应用更改后数据到 Power BI。 image.png 5.如何添加更多数据源? 如果要向现有报表添加更多数据源,在功能栏中选择“新建源”。...如何行列? Power BI 可视化效果建模工具最适用于列式数据,也就是我们通常看到Excel按每一列名排列数据。 但是,有时候给到你是按行排列如何实现行列呢?...点击Power Query编辑器中”,可以将行替换为。 image.png 操作步骤动图演示: image.png 推荐:人人都需要数据分析思维 image.png

    3.3K00

    如何用Power BI获取数据?

    image.png (3)内容页面:显示当前表格内容。 (4)查询设置:列出查询属性已应用步骤。 选中要编辑列名,鼠标右键,可以出现:表中删除、以新名称复制或替换。...image.png 每个步骤都会显示在“查询设置”窗格上“已应用步骤”列表中。你可以使用此列表撤消或查看特定更改,点击X即可。还可以更改步骤名称。...选择“关闭并应用”后,Power Query编辑器将应用更改后数据到 Power BI。 image.png 5.如何添加更多数据源? 如果要向现有报表添加更多数据源,在功能栏中选择“新建源”。...如何行列? Power BI 可视化效果建模工具最适用于列式数据,也就是我们通常看到Excel按每一列名排列数据。 但是,有时候给到你是按行排列如何实现行列呢?...点击Power Query编辑器中”,可以将行替换为。 image.png 操作步骤动图演示: image.png 推荐:人人都需要数据分析思维

    4.3K00

    Matlab矩阵基本操作(定义,运算)

    二、矩阵简单操作 1.获取矩阵元素 可以通过下标(行列索引)引用矩阵元素,如 Matrix(m,n)。 也可以采用矩阵元素序号引用矩阵元素。...(5) 矩阵 对实数矩阵进行行列互换,对复数矩阵,共轭,特殊,操作符.’共轭不(见点运算); (6) 点运算在MATLAB中,有一种特殊运算,因为其运算符是在有关算术运算符前面加点,...3、矩阵与旋转 (1) 矩阵 运算符是单撇号(’)。 (2) 矩阵旋转 利用函数rot90(A,k)将矩阵A旋转90ok倍,当k为1时可省略。...4、矩阵翻转 对矩阵实施左右翻转是将原矩阵一列最后一列调换,第二倒数第二调换,…,依次类推。...(2) 直接创建稀疏矩阵 S=sparse(i,j,s,m,n),其中i j 分别是矩阵非零元素指标向量,s 是非零元素向量,m,n 分别是矩阵行数数。

    2.4K20

    PHP数据结构(五) ——数组压缩与

    (三角矩阵为一半有,另一半为0矩阵) 存储N阶对称矩阵方式,即以对称对角线为分界,仅取其中一半内容以及对角线进行存储。...该方法存储表,要进行操作非常便利。需要进行三步操作,分别是:行列进行转换、ij进行转换、重新从小到大排列ij。因此,重点在于最后一步——排序。...对于排序,可以通过从0开始扫描原数组,并将结果相应放入数组行。也可以采用下述快速法。...快速数组算法: 假设原矩阵为M,矩阵为T,引入两个数组,数组num[col]为第col非零元个数,cpot[col]为第col第一个非零元在矩阵T生成三元组顺序表位置。...php //快速稀疏矩阵 //根据原标准三元数组获取每一列非零元个数及第一个非零元位置 /* 输入要求 array( 0=>array(0,1,33), 1=>

    2.2K110

    matlab 稀疏矩阵 乘法,Matlab 矩阵运算

    也可以采用矩阵元素序号引用矩阵元素。矩阵元素序号就是相应元素在内存中排列顺序。在MATLAB中,矩阵元素按存 储,先第一列,再第二,依次类推。...(5) 矩阵 对实数矩阵进行行列互换,对复数矩阵,共轭,特殊,操作符.’共轭不(见点运算); (6) 点运算 在MATLAB中,有一种特殊运算,因为其运算符是在有关算术运算符前面加点,...3、矩阵与旋转 (1) 矩阵 运算符是单撇号(’)。 (2) 矩阵旋转 利用函数rot90(A,k)将矩阵A旋转90ºk倍,当k为1时可省略。...4、矩阵翻转 对矩阵实施左右翻转是将原矩阵一列最后一列调换,第二倒数第二调换,…,依次类推。...(2) 直接创建稀疏矩阵 S=sparse(i,j,s,m,n),其中i j 分别是矩阵非零元素指标向量,s 是非零元素向量,m,n 分别是矩阵行数数。

    2.9K30

    生信技能树-R语言-day3

    3> df1[,2] # 逗号右边数字,取第二[1] "up" "up" "down" "down" > df1[c(1,3),1:2] # 逗号前第一第三行,逗号后一列到第二...,按照逻辑取子集,所以保留了score>0数据 gene change score1 gene1 up 52 gene2 up 3 #因为是一个矩阵,所以要有逗号区分行数据修改修改一个数据文件名...,之前不存在)修改行名rownames() = c()赋值修改后向量 (行名都是一样)修改其中一列列名colnames(文件名)[第几列]= “”赋值名字(每一列名字都不一样)两个数据框连接...t()(将行互转,要先给改名,不然没有区别> colnames(m) m a b c[1,] 1 4 7...[2,] 2 5 8 [3,] 3 6 9 > t(m) # [,1] [,2] [,3]a 1 2 3b 4 5 6c 7 8

    6910
    领券